What is a solution?
One phase system with more than one component in a homogeneous mixture
Compare ideal gas mixtures with ideal solution
i.g. has no intermolecular interactions
i.s. the species of one componenet can replace those of another component without changing the (1) spacial structure of solution and (2) the energy of intermolecular interactions
What would make A and B an ideal solution?
A and B have similar size and shape
A-A, A-B, and B-B bonds have similar interaction energies
Why does ideal solution mixing not change V, U, H?
(AT CONST T AND P) mixing of components of i.s. does not change the internal interaction energy of the components
For i.s. why is ΔG ≤ 0 for mixing for all compositions?
Only effect of mixing of an i.s. is to make components more randomly ordered, which is always a spontaneous process
A solution w/ any composition can form if it’s ideal
For binary i.s., why is ΔG minimum for mixing when xA=xB=0.5?
Most randomly occured distribution in a solution occurs when components are present in equal amounts
